The compliance of purchasing DeFi Land (KUMA) in America

Compliance Description for Purchasing DeFi Land (KUMA) in America Regulatory Framework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C): The SEC plays a critical role in regulating securities, which may encompass certain digital assets like DeFi Land (KUMA). Investors should be aware that the classification of KUMA could impact their investment strategy and compliance obligations. Commodity Futures Trading Commission (CFTC): Digital assets may be classified under commodities, affecting how KUMA can be traded in futures and derivatives markets. Users should familiarize themselves with these classifications and their implications. Financial Crimes Enforcement Network (FinCEN): FinCEN mandates that cryptocurrency exchanges comply with anti-money laundering (AML) and know-your-customer (KYC) regulations. This means that users may need to undergo identity verification processes before purchasing KUMA. Compliance Considerations for Users Tax Obligations: The Internal Revenue Service (IRS) treats cryptocurrencies, including KUMA, as property. This classification subjects transactions to capital gains taxes, requiring users to maintain accurate records for tax reporting purposes. Privacy and Security: When purchasing KUMA through exchanges that implement KYC procedures, users should ensure their personal information is protected. It is advisable to use secure platforms that prioritize user data privacy. State-Level Regulations: Each state may have unique regulations regarding cryptocurrency transactions, including specific licenses or exemptions. Users should familiarize themselves with local laws to avoid potential legal complications. Best Practices for Users Stay Informed: Regulatory landscapes can change rapidly. Users should keep abreast of any new regulations or proposed laws that may affect the purchase and trading of KUMA. Choose Reputable Exchanges: Opt for exchanges that are compliant with AML and KYC regulations. This not only enhances security but also ensures that transactions are conducted in a compliant manner. Record Keeping: Maintain comprehensive records of all transactions involving KUMA, including purchase dates, amounts, and associated costs. This documentation is essential for tax purposes and to prepare for any potential audits.
